- #include <debug.h>
- #include <string.h>
- #include <lib/console.h>
- #include <lib/fs.h>
- #include <stdlib.h>
- #include <platform.h>
- #if defined(WITH_LIB_CONSOLE)
- #if DEBUGLEVEL > 1
- static int cmd_fs(int argc, const cmd_args *argv);
- STATIC_COMMAND_START
- STATIC_COMMAND("fs", "fs debug commands", &cmd_fs)
- STATIC_COMMAND_END(fs);
- extern int fs_mount_type(const char *path, const char *device, const char *name);
- extern int fs_create_file(const char *path, filecookie *fcookie);
- extern int fs_make_dir(const char *path);
- extern int fs_write_file(filecookie fcookie, const void *buf, off_t offset, size_t len);
- static int cmd_fs(int argc, const cmd_args *argv)
- {
- int rc = 0;
- if (argc < 2) {
- notenoughargs:
- printf("not enough arguments:\n");
- usage:
- printf("%s mount <path> <device> [<type>]\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s unmount <path>\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s create <path>\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s mkdir <path>\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s read <path> [<offset>] [<len>]\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s write <path> <string> [<offset>]\n", argv[0].str);
- printf("%s stat <file>\n", argv[0].str);
- return -1;
- }
- if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"mount")) {
- int err;
- if (argc < 4)
- goto notenoughargs;
- if (argc < 5)
- err = fs_mount(argv[2].str, argv[3].str);
- else
- err = fs_mount_type(argv[2].str, argv[3].str, argv[4].str);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d mounting device\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"unmount")) {
- int err;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_unmount(argv[2].str);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d unmounting device\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"create")) {
- int err;
- filecookie cookie;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_create_file(argv[2].str, &cookie);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d creating file\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"mkdir")) {
- int err;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_make_dir(argv[2].str);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d making directory\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"read")) {
- int err;
- char *buf;
- off_t off;
- size_t len;
- filecookie cookie;
- struct file_stat stat;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_open_file(argv[2].str, &cookie);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d opening file\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- err = fs_stat_file(cookie, &stat);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d stat'ing file\n", err);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- return err;
- }
- if (argc < 4)
- off = 0;
- else
- off = argv[3].u;
- if (argc < 5)
- len = stat.size - off;
- else
- len = argv[4].u;
- buf = malloc(len + 1);
- err = fs_read_file(cookie, buf, off, len);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d reading file\n", err);
- free(buf);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- return err;
- }
- buf[len] = '\0';
- printf("%s\n", buf);
- free(buf);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"write")) {
- int err;
- off_t off;
- filecookie cookie;
- struct file_stat stat;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_open_file(argv[2].str, &cookie);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d opening file\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- err = fs_stat_file(cookie, &stat);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d stat'ing file\n", err);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- return err;
- }
- if (argc < 5)
- off = stat.size;
- else
- off = argv[4].u;
- err = fs_write_file(cookie, argv[3].str, off, strlen(argv[3].str));
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d writing file\n", err);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- return err;
- }
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- } else if (!strcmp(argv[1].str, "stat")) {
- int err;
- struct file_stat stat;
- filecookie cookie;
- if (argc < 3)
- goto notenoughargs;
- err = fs_open_file(argv[2].str, &cookie);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d opening file\n", err);
- return err;
- }
- err = fs_stat_file(cookie, &stat);
- if (err < 0) {
- printf("error %d statting file\n", err);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- return err;
- }
- printf("stat successful:\n");
- printf("\tis_dir: %d\n", stat.is_dir ? 1 : 0);
- printf("\tsize: %lld\n", stat.size);
- fs_close_file(cookie);
- } else {
- printf("unrecognized subcommand\n");
- goto usage;
- }
- return rc;
- }
- #endif
- #endif
